类库 › evcc
evcc-io

evcc-io/evcc

evcc是一个可扩展的电动汽车充电控制器和家庭能源管理系统,专注于本地能源管理,不依赖云服务。它支持众多品牌充电桩,提供简洁的用户界面,帮助用户利用太阳能等绿色能源为电动汽车充电并管理家庭用电。

6,245 1,215 6,245 129
在 GitHub 上查看

技术栈

框架

Vue Router ^5.0.2 Vue.js ^3.2.29

构建工具

Vite ^8.0.0

测试

Playwright ^1.57.0 Vitest ^4.1.0

网络

Axios ^1.13.5

代码规范

ESLint ^9.39.2 Prettier ^3.7.4
查看全部依赖 (175)

依赖

@formkit/drag-and-drop ^0.5.3 @guolao/vue-monaco-editor 1.5.5 @h2d2/shopicons ^1.9.0 @popperjs/core ^2.11.8 @unhead/vue ^2.1.12 bootstrap ^5.3.8 canvas-confetti ^1.9.4 chart.js ^4.5.1 chartjs-adapter-dayjs-4 ^1.0.4 chartjs-plugin-datalabels ^2.2.0 countup.js ^2.10.0 dario.cat/mergo v1.0.2 dayjs ^1.11.19 github.com/AlecAivazis/survey/v2 v2.3.7 github.com/Masterminds/sprig/v3 v3.3.0 github.com/PuerkitoBio/goquery v1.11.0 github.com/WulfgarW/sensonet v0.0.7 github.com/andig/go-powerwall v0.3.0 github.com/andig/gosunspec v0.0.0-20240918203654-860ce51d602b github.com/andig/mbserver v0.0.0-20230310211055-1d29cbb5820e github.com/asaskevich/EventBus v0.0.0-20200907212545-49d423059eef github.com/aws/aws-sdk-go-v2 v1.41.3 github.com/aws/aws-sdk-go-v2/config v1.32.11 github.com/aws/aws-sdk-go-v2/credentials v1.19.11 github.com/aws/aws-sdk-go-v2/service/cognitoidentity v1.33.20 github.com/basgys/goxml2json v1.1.0 github.com/basvdlei/gotsmart v0.0.3 github.com/benbjohnson/clock v1.3.5 github.com/bogosj/tesla v1.3.2-0.20250818120641-a31b7b6396c9 github.com/cenkalti/backoff/v4 v4.3.0 github.com/cli/browser v1.3.0 github.com/cloudfoundry/jibber_jabber v0.0.0-20151120183258-bcc4c8345a21 github.com/coder/websocket v1.8.14 github.com/coreos/go-oidc/v3 v3.17.0 github.com/denisbrodbeck/machineid v1.0.1 github.com/dylanmei/iso8601 v0.1.0 github.com/eclipse/paho.mqtt.golang v1.5.1 github.com/enbility/eebus-go v0.7.0 github.com/enbility/ship-go v0.6.0 github.com/enbility/spine-go v0.7.0 github.com/evcc-io/openapi-mcp v0.6.0 github.com/evcc-io/optimizer v0.0.0-20260314150137-cff404fedb5e github.com/evcc-io/rct v0.2.0 github.com/evcc-io/tesla-proxy-client v0.0.0-20240221194046-4168b3759701 github.com/fatih/structs v1.1.0 github.com/getkin/kin-openapi v0.133.0 github.com/glebarez/sqlite v1.11.0 github.com/go-http-utils/etag v0.0.0-20161124023236-513ea8f21eb1 github.com/go-playground/validator/v10 v10.30.1 github.com/go-telegram/bot v1.19.0 github.com/go-viper/mapstructure/v2 v2.5.0 github.com/godbus/dbus/v5 v5.2.2 github.com/gokrazy/updater v0.0.0-20250705135802-db129c40879c github.com/golang-jwt/jwt/v5 v5.3.1 github.com/google/go-github/v32 v32.1.0 github.com/google/uuid v1.6.0 github.com/gorilla/handlers v1.5.2 github.com/gorilla/mux v1.8.1 github.com/gosimple/slug v1.15.0 github.com/gregdel/pushover v1.4.0 github.com/grid-x/modbus v0.0.0-20260122103929-e192bc287e6e github.com/hashicorp/go-version v1.8.0 github.com/hasura/go-graphql-client v0.15.1 github.com/holoplot/go-evdev v0.0.0-20250804134636-ab1d56a1fe83 github.com/influxdata/influxdb-client-go/v2 v2.14.0 github.com/insomniacslk/tapo v1.0.2 github.com/itchyny/gojq v0.12.18 github.com/jarcoal/httpmock v1.4.1 github.com/jeremywohl/flatten v1.0.1 github.com/jinzhu/now v1.1.5 github.com/joeshaw/carwings v0.0.0-20250704173606-1708e349f36c github.com/joho/godotenv v1.5.1 github.com/jpfielding/go-http-digest v0.0.0-20240123121450-cffc47d5d6d8 github.com/kballard/go-shellquote v0.0.0-20180428030007-95032a82bc51 github.com/koron/go-ssdp v0.1.0 github.com/korylprince/ipnetgen v1.0.1 github.com/libp2p/zeroconf/v2 v2.2.0 github.com/lorenzodonini/ocpp-go v0.19.0 github.com/lunixbochs/struc v0.0.0-20241101090106-8d528fa2c543 github.com/mabunixda/wattpilot v1.8.5 github.com/mitchellh/go-homedir v1.1.0 github.com/modelcontextprotocol/go-sdk v1.4.1 github.com/muka/go-bluetooth v0.0.0-20240701044517-04c4f09c514e github.com/mxschmitt/golang-combinations v1.2.0 github.com/nicholas-fedor/shoutrrr v0.14.0 github.com/nicksnyder/go-i18n/v2 v2.6.1 github.com/olekukonko/tablewriter v1.1.4 github.com/philippseith/signalr v0.8.0 github.com/prometheus-community/pro-bing v0.8.0 github.com/prometheus/client_golang v1.23.2 github.com/prometheus/common v0.67.5 github.com/robertkrimen/otto v0.5.1 github.com/samber/lo v1.53.0 github.com/sandrolain/httpcache v1.4.0 github.com/sirupsen/logrus v1.9.4 github.com/skratchdot/open-golang v0.0.0-20200116055534-eef842397966 github.com/smallnest/chanx v1.2.0 github.com/spali/go-rscp v0.2.2 github.com/spf13/cast v1.10.0 github.com/spf13/cobra v1.10.2 github.com/spf13/jwalterweatherman v1.1.0 github.com/spf13/pflag v1.0.10 github.com/spf13/viper v1.21.0 github.com/stretchr/testify v1.11.1 github.com/teslamotors/vehicle-command v0.4.1 github.com/tess1o/go-ecoflow v1.1.1-0.20251003083510-2ccc15a17e29 github.com/traefik/yaegi v0.16.1 github.com/volkszaehler/mbmd v0.0.0-20260131091050-86c2d25b6103 github.com/warthog618/go-gpiocdev v0.9.1 gitlab.com/bboehmke/sunny v0.16.0 go.bug.st/serial v1.6.4 go.uber.org/mock v0.6.0 go.yaml.in/yaml/v4 v4.0.0-rc.4 golang.org/x/crypto v0.49.0 golang.org/x/crypto/x509roots/fallback v0.0.0-20260311141749-982eaa62dfb7 golang.org/x/exp v0.0.0-20260312153236-7ab1446f8b90 golang.org/x/net v0.52.0 golang.org/x/oauth2 v0.36.0 golang.org/x/sync v0.20.0 golang.org/x/text v0.35.0 golang.org/x/tools v0.43.0 google.golang.org/grpc v1.79.2 google.golang.org/protobuf v1.36.11 gorm.io/gorm v1.31.1 monaco-editor 0.52.2 smoothscroll-polyfill ^0.4.4 snarkdown ^2.0.0 vue-chartjs ^5.3.3 vue-i18n ^11.3.0

开发依赖

@eslint/eslintrc ^3.3.3 @eslint/js ^9.13.0 @jest/types ^30.2.0 @storybook/vue3 ^10.2.19 @storybook/vue3-vite ^10.2.19 @types/body-parser ^1.19.6 @types/bootstrap ^5.2.10 @types/canvas-confetti ^1.9.0 @types/kill-port ^2.0.3 @types/smoothscroll-polyfill ^0.3.4 @types/wait-on ^5.3.4 @types/ws ^8.18.1 @vitejs/plugin-legacy ^8.0.0 @vitejs/plugin-vue ^6.0.5 @vue/compiler-sfc ^3.2.30 @vue/eslint-config-prettier ^10.2.0 @vue/eslint-config-typescript ^14.6.0 @vue/test-utils ^2.4.6 @vue/tsconfig ^0.9.0 body-parser ^2.2.1 cross-env ^10.1.0 eslint-config-prettier ^10.1.8 eslint-plugin-import ^2.32.0 eslint-plugin-node ^11.1.0 eslint-plugin-prettier ^5.5.4 eslint-plugin-promise ^7.2.1 eslint-plugin-vue ^10.6.2 globals ^17.0.0 happy-dom ^20.0.11 jiti ^2.6.1 kill-port ^2.0.1 license-compliance ^3.0.1 mqtt ^5.14.1 prettier-plugin-sh ^0.18.0 prettier-plugin-sort-json ^4.1.1 rollup-plugin-visualizer ^7.0.1 storybook ^10.2.19 terser ^5.44.1 tsx ^4.21.0 typescript ^5.9.3 typescript-eslint-language-service ^5.0.5 vue-eslint-parser ^10.2.0 vue-hot-reload-api ^2.3.4 vue-tsc ^3.1.8 wait-on ^9.0.3 ws ^8.18.3

截图

Weblate Hosted

评论

ホーム - Wiki
Copyright © 2011-2026 iteam. Current version is 2.155.1. UTC+08:00, 2026-04-09 16:34
浙ICP备14020137号-1 $お客様$